ESP8266 WebServer / JSON / CSV 串流
姓名阮阿璽   _阮文孟 學號: 1111310022_1111310035

1.       安裝Arduino IDE

2.     安裝CH340 Drivers

3.     Arduino IDE 設定

4.     使用 Windows 搜尋 裝置管理員

5.     安裝 ESP8266 項目

6.     選擇1115200

7.     選擇 NodeMCU 1.0

8.     選擇 COM5

9.     貼上 Code, 在修改個人網路

10.  執行程式

心得學習:NodeMCUESP8266)光敏監測 + Web Server + CSV 下載

這次用 NodeMCU 實作光敏監測專案,讓我學到不少東西:

1.      ESP8266 的功能NodeMCU Wi-Fi 功能很強大,能輕鬆連網並建立 Web 伺服器,實現即時資料顯示和下載,適合 IoT 應用。

2.      LDR 光敏感測:用 LDR 讀取光線強度,學會如何處理類比訊號,了解 ADC 的運作。

3.      檔案系統:用 LittleFS 儲存 CSV 檔案,學到如何管理資料、附加記錄,並控制檔案大小避免記憶體問題。

4.      Web 伺服器:用 ESP8266WebServer 建網頁,透過 HTML JavaScript 實現即時資料更新,學到前端後端互動。

5.      CSV 下載:實作資料記錄和下載功能,學會結構化儲存資料並傳送到客戶端。

6.      穩定性:加入錯誤檢查和記憶體監控,學到如何讓程式更穩定,例如連線失敗或記憶體不足時重啟。